Jo-Anne McArthur / Israel Against Live Shipments / We Animals Description: The Bahijah, a ship carrying between 20,000 and 30,000 sheep and cattle from Australia to Israel, arrives at the Haifa port after almost three weeks at sea. The animals are then offloaded onto trucks which will carry them to quarantine, feedlots or directly to slaughter. The cruelty inherent in long-distance transport of animals by sea has been a focus of animal rights campaigners for decades.
